在当今高度依赖互联网的环境中,虚拟私人网络(VPN)已成为企业办公、远程访问、隐私保护和跨境访问的重要工具,许多用户在使用过程中会遇到一个常见却令人困扰的问题——“VPN自己退出”,即连接状态突然中断,无法维持稳定通信,这种现象不仅影响工作效率,还可能带来数据泄露或访问权限失效的风险,本文将从技术原理出发,系统分析可能导致VPN自动断开的原因,并提供实用的解决策略。
我们需要明确“VPN自己退出”的几种典型表现:可能是连接瞬间中断、一段时间后自动断线、或在特定时间段频繁掉线,这些现象背后往往隐藏着多种原因,包括客户端配置错误、服务器端策略限制、网络波动、防火墙干扰,甚至设备硬件问题。
最常见的原因是Keep-Alive机制失效,大多数VPN协议(如OpenVPN、IPSec、WireGuard)都依赖心跳包(Keep-Alive)来维持连接活跃状态,如果客户端或服务器长时间未收到心跳信号,就会认为连接已失效并主动断开,这通常发生在路由器NAT超时设置过短(如默认30秒)、移动网络切换(Wi-Fi转4G)、或本地防火墙/杀毒软件拦截了UDP/TCP端口。
服务器端策略配置不当也可能导致自动断开,某些企业级或商业VPN服务会在用户空闲超过一定时间(如10分钟)后强制注销会话,以节省资源或增强安全性,检查服务器端日志可确认是否有“Session timeout”或“User logout”记录。
第三,网络环境不稳定是另一个高频诱因,如果你通过无线网络(尤其是公共Wi-Fi)连接,信号波动或带宽不足可能导致连接中断,部分ISP(互联网服务提供商)会对加密流量进行限速或干扰,尤其在使用非标准端口(如OpenVPN默认的1194)时更容易触发行为检测机制。
解决此类问题,建议按以下步骤排查:
- 更新客户端与固件:确保使用的VPN客户端版本为最新,同时检查路由器固件是否需要升级,老旧版本可能不支持现代协议或存在安全漏洞。
- 调整Keep-Alive参数:在客户端配置中增加心跳间隔(如设置为60秒),或启用“TCP模式”替代UDP(虽然速度稍慢但更稳定)。
- 关闭防火墙/杀毒软件临时测试:排除第三方软件误判为恶意流量而阻断连接的可能性。
- 更换DNS与端口:尝试使用自定义DNS(如Google DNS 8.8.8.8)或切换至非标准端口(如443),避开ISP对特定端口的限制。
- 联系服务商获取日志:若上述方法无效,应向VPN服务提供商申请连接日志,定位是客户端还是服务端的问题。
“VPN自己退出”并非单一故障,而是多因素叠加的结果,作为网络工程师,应具备系统化思维,从用户终端、网络链路到服务端层层排查,才能从根本上解决问题,保障网络连接的稳定性与安全性。

半仙加速器






